Crime Solvers Central is an online true crime platform and searchable cold case database focused on missing persons, unsolved homicides, unidentified remains, and unclaimed persons. The website publishes case information, hosts community features, and operates related social media and video content under the name Crime Solvers Central.[1][2]
Overview
Crime Solvers Central describes itself as a platform for cold case advocacy and a resource for people interested in missing persons cases, unsolved homicides, unidentified remains, and unclaimed persons.[3] Its website includes a database that can be searched by case type and browsed by state.[4]
As of May 2026, the website stated that its database contained more than 260,000 cold case-related records, including records categorized as deaths by force, missing persons, unidentified persons, and unclaimed persons.[1] The site also stated that it tracked recently added cases and case updates.[5]
Website features
Crime Solvers Central includes tools and sections for searching cases, browsing recently updated cases, reading news and blog posts, and participating in community features such as forums.[4][5][6]
The site provides case-related tools, including a missing persons poster creator, also described in the site navigation as a flyer builder, and online evidence boards. The evidence board feature allows users to organize case information visually, and the site provides a tutorial for using the tool.[7]
Crime Solvers Central also operates a volunteer program for people interested in cold case advocacy and citizen-detective work. The volunteer page states that volunteers may help with case research, evidence analysis, database contributions, and support for families connected to unsolved cases.[8]
The website includes a Search Army registration page, described as a way for participants to be contacted about search efforts in their area.[9] It also hosts a National Security Camera Registry, which allows individuals to register surveillance-camera locations for possible use as a law-enforcement resource. The registry page states that Crime Solvers Central does not request or access live camera feeds.[10]
Crime Solvers Central maintains pages for case-related fundraisers and donations. Its fundraiser page lists case fundraisers, while its donation page states that community donations support the site’s services and its work with families seeking closure.[11]
The site also publishes testimonials and impact stories related to its cold case advocacy work. Its testimonials page describes stories from families of unsolved murder victims and members of the true crime community.[12]
In addition to its database and community tools, Crime Solvers Central publishes a true crime news section covering missing persons cases, unsolved homicides, cold cases, and related public-safety news.[13]
Media presence
Crime Solvers Central maintains a YouTube channel that publishes videos about missing persons, unsolved murders, serial killers, and related true crime topics. The channel description states that it focuses on unresolved cases and victim awareness.[2] A YouTube collaboration video described Crime Solvers Central as a channel dedicated to discussing real cases, unsolved mysteries, and stories that deserve attention.[14]
Funding and membership
Crime Solvers Central offers paid membership options. Its membership page states that a portion of profits is reinvested into data resources, YouTube content, vodcasts, and providing data to law enforcement.[15]
